Russian processor Baltic Coast is planning on hitting 40,000 metric tons of farmed salmon production by 2013, as it pumps millions of dollars into aquaculture.

The company, based in St. Petersburg, has invested $70 million into its salmon farming in the Murmansk region, and plans to produce 10,000 metric tons this year, said Julia Leontyeva, its import manager.  

“In 2011, we produced 3,000 metric tons of salmon, in 2012 we plan 10,000 metric tons and in a couple of years; 40,000 metric tons,” she told IntraFish.
